Nutritional Powerhouse: What Makes Walnuts Unique?

A standard one-ounce serving of walnuts (approximately 14 halves) provides a robust blend of macronutrients and micronutrients, distinguishing them from other tree nuts. This serving size delivers about 185 calories, 4 grams of protein, 2.5 grams of fiber, and 18 grams of healthy fats.

The Importance of Alpha-Linolenic Acid (ALA)

Walnuts are the only common nut that provides significant amounts of ALA, an essential omega-3 fatty acid. ALA is crucial because the human body cannot produce it, requiring intake through diet. Once consumed, ALA is partially converted into the longer-chain omega-3s, EPA and DHA, which are vital for reducing inflammation and supporting neurological function. A single ounce of walnuts typically contains over 2.5 grams of ALA, meeting and often exceeding the daily recommended intake for adults.

Antioxidant Capacity: Polyphenols and Vitamin E

Beyond healthy fats, walnuts possess superior antioxidant activity compared to most other nuts. This is largely attributed to their high concentration of polyphenols, particularly ellagitannins, which are found primarily in the papery skin. These compounds are potent free-radical scavengers, helping to combat oxidative stress—a key driver of chronic diseases.

Furthermore, walnuts are a good source of Vitamin E, specifically the gamma-tocopherol form, which plays a critical role in protecting cell membranes from damage.


Cardiovascular Health: Protecting the Heart and Arteries

The most extensively studied benefit of walnuts relates to their profound positive impact on the cardiovascular system. Regular consumption of walnuts is strongly associated with improved heart health outcomes, a critical consideration for long-term wellness.

Impact on Cholesterol and Lipid Profiles

Decades of clinical research consistently show that incorporating walnuts into the diet can significantly improve blood lipid profiles. This effect is multifaceted:

  1. Lowering LDL Cholesterol: The combination of polyunsaturated fats (PUFAs) and phytosterols in walnuts helps reduce levels of low-density lipoprotein (LDL) cholesterol, often referred to as “bad” cholesterol.
  2. Improving HDL Function: Walnuts have been shown to improve the function of high-density lipoprotein (HDL) cholesterol, enhancing its ability to remove excess cholesterol from the bloodstream.
  3. Reducing Triglycerides: The high ALA content helps lower circulating triglyceride levels, especially in individuals with elevated risk factors for metabolic syndrome.

Blood Pressure Regulation and Endothelial Function

Walnuts contribute to better blood pressure control, particularly diastolic blood pressure, which measures the pressure in the arteries when the heart rests between beats. This benefit is linked to the nuts’ arginine content, an amino acid that the body uses to produce nitric oxide.

Nitric oxide is a powerful vasodilator, meaning it helps relax and widen blood vessels, improving blood flow and reducing the strain on the heart. Enhanced endothelial function—the health of the inner lining of blood vessels—is a direct result of this improved nitric oxide availability, leading to more flexible and responsive arteries.

Cognitive Function and Brain Health

The brain-like appearance of the walnut kernel is perhaps nature’s hint at its primary benefit. Walnuts are essential for maintaining optimal cognitive function throughout life, addressing concerns about memory and age-related decline.

Neuroprotection and Memory Enhancement

The high concentration of ALA and antioxidants provides a protective shield for brain cells. The brain is particularly vulnerable to oxidative stress due to its high oxygen consumption. The polyphenols in walnuts help neutralize these damaging free radicals, preserving neuronal integrity.

Studies suggest that regular walnut consumption can improve working memory, processing speed, and overall cognitive performance. This is particularly relevant for maintaining mental sharpness as we age.

Walnuts and Age-Related Cognitive Decline

For older adults, walnuts offer a promising dietary intervention against neurodegenerative conditions. The anti-inflammatory properties of omega-3s are crucial in mitigating chronic low-grade inflammation, which is implicated in the progression of Alzheimer’s and Parkinson’s diseases. By supporting the health of the brain’s vascular system, walnuts ensure a steady supply of oxygen and nutrients, which is fundamental to preventing cognitive impairment.

Walnuts for Metabolic Health and Weight Management

Despite being calorie-dense, walnuts are frequently associated with better weight management and improved metabolic markers, debunking the myth that all high-fat foods lead to weight gain.

Satiety and Appetite Control

Walnuts are highly satiating due to their combination of fiber, protein, and healthy fats. Including them as a snack or part of a meal can significantly increase feelings of fullness, leading to a natural reduction in overall caloric intake later in the day. This effect helps manage cravings and supports adherence to a balanced diet.

Role in Blood Sugar Regulation

For individuals concerned about blood sugar control, walnuts offer significant advantages. Their low glycemic index means they have minimal impact on blood glucose levels. Furthermore, the fiber and fat content slow down the absorption of carbohydrates, leading to a more stable insulin response. Current research suggests that regular walnut consumption may improve insulin sensitivity, making them a valuable addition to the diet for preventing or managing type 2 diabetes.

Walnuts Health Benefits for Men

Research has highlighted the positive effects of walnuts on male reproductive health. The high omega-3 content, coupled with potent antioxidants, has been shown to improve sperm quality, including motility, morphology, and vitality. This is attributed to the reduction of oxidative damage to sperm cell membranes. Furthermore, the anti-inflammatory properties may contribute to long-term prostate health.

Digestive Wellness and the Gut Microbiome

Emerging research emphasizes the critical link between diet and the gut microbiome—the community of microorganisms residing in the digestive tract. Walnuts act as a prebiotic, feeding beneficial gut bacteria.

The fiber and polyphenols in walnuts are not fully digested in the small intestine. They travel to the colon, where they are fermented by gut bacteria. This process produces beneficial short-chain fatty acids (SCFAs), such as butyrate, which nourish the colon lining, reduce inflammation, and support overall immune function. A healthy, diverse gut microbiome is increasingly linked to improved mental health and systemic wellness.

Integrating Walnuts into a Gluten-Free Lifestyle

For individuals adhering to a gluten-free diet, walnuts are an indispensable ingredient. They provide essential nutrients—fiber, healthy fats, and micronutrients—that can sometimes be deficient when relying heavily on processed gluten-free alternatives.

Walnuts are naturally gluten-free and incredibly versatile. They can be used whole, chopped, or ground into a nutrient-dense flour substitute. Walnut flour, for instance, can be combined with other gluten-free flours to add richness and protein to baked goods, or used as a coating for savory dishes.

When sourcing walnuts, especially for those with severe sensitivities, it is important to ensure they are processed in a dedicated facility or one with strict cross-contamination protocols, although walnuts themselves pose no gluten risk.

Potential Side Effects and Safe Consumption

While walnuts are overwhelmingly beneficial, responsible consumption requires awareness of potential side effects, primarily related to allergies and caloric density.

Allergies

Walnut allergy is one of the most common and severe tree nut allergies. Symptoms can range from mild oral allergy syndrome to life-threatening anaphylaxis. Individuals with known tree nut allergies must strictly avoid walnuts.

Caloric Density

Walnuts are high in healthy fats and, consequently, calories. While they aid in weight management through satiety, consuming excessive quantities (more than the recommended 1-2 ounces per day) without adjusting other caloric intake can lead to weight gain. Moderation is key to reaping the health benefits without adverse effects.

Digestive Issues

Due to their high fiber and fat content, consuming very large amounts of walnuts quickly can sometimes lead to temporary digestive discomfort, such as bloating or gas, especially in individuals not accustomed to high-fiber diets.

Frequently Asked Questions (FAQ)

Q: How many walnuts should I eat per day to see health benefits?

A: Most clinical studies demonstrating significant health benefits, particularly for cardiovascular health, use a serving size of 1 ounce (about 14 halves) per day. This amount provides the optimal dose of ALA and antioxidants without excessive caloric intake.

Q: Are walnuts better than other nuts like almonds or pecans?

A: Walnuts are nutritionally unique due to their significantly higher content of ALA (omega-3 fatty acid). While almonds are excellent sources of Vitamin E and calcium, and pecans offer high levels of antioxidants, walnuts are generally considered superior for anti-inflammatory and cardiovascular benefits specifically related to omega-3 intake.

Q: Do walnuts lose their nutritional value when cooked or baked?

A: Walnuts are relatively stable, but the delicate omega-3 fatty acids (ALA) are susceptible to oxidation when exposed to high heat for prolonged periods. To preserve maximum nutritional value, it is best to consume them raw or lightly toasted. If baking, store the nuts in the refrigerator or freezer prior to use to maintain freshness.

Q: Can walnuts help lower blood pressure?

A: Yes. Walnuts contain arginine, which is converted into nitric oxide, a compound that helps relax blood vessels. Regular consumption, as part of a balanced diet, has been shown to contribute to modest but significant reductions in blood pressure, particularly diastolic pressure.

Q: Are walnuts safe for someone following a strict gluten-free diet?

A: Walnuts are naturally gluten-free. They are a highly recommended food for those following a gluten-free diet as they provide essential nutrients often missing from processed gluten-free foods. Always check packaging for cross-contamination warnings if you have celiac disease.
